This week on The Africa EV Show we’re skipping the climate pitch and diving into the business playbook—discussing market segmentation, distribution, customer financing, and what it takes to scale an EV hardware company in a challenging yet high-potential market like Nigeria.

In this episode of the Africa EV Show, Njenga Hakeenah interviews Kenneth Ukpabia, CEO of Orbit Electric, about the company's innovative approach to electric mobility in Nigeria. They discuss the CF-1 electric motorcycle, focusing on market segmentation, logistics, strategies for affordability, and customer preferences regarding battery ownership. The conversation highlights the challenges and opportunities in the Nigerian electric vehicle market, emphasizing the importance of local assembly and customer-centric solutions.

Ukpabia also highlights the improvements in electricity supply in Lagos and outlines potential expansion plans beyond Nigeria.
